Ford Mustang Mach-E: ignore the name and fake engine noise, this is a solid electric car – TechRadar
A Mustang by name, not by nature – but that’s okay

The Ford Mustang Mach-E isn’t a traditional Mustang. A two-door muscle car this is not, but you almost need to ignore the Mustang name altogether, because as an all-electric car the Mach-E has a lot going for it.
It’s Ford’s first foray into the fully electric car world, and while it certainly raised eyebrows when it slapped the iconic pony badge onto the front of this SUV, there’s enough here to potentially worry the likes of Tesla and Audi.
